Tools for yield prediction are requisite to any successful heterosis breeding program. In this study, heterosis was evaluated by 42 crosses develop by line x tester design (14 lines and 3 testers) along with 2 checks in RBD with 3 replications in wheat for earliness and heat tolerant traits viz.,days to 50 per cent flowering, heat injury, proline content and total chlorophyll content on pooled basis. The pooled analysis for above characters revealed that mean squares due to environments, genotypes, parents, crosses as well as parents v/s. crosses were significant indicating presence of overall heterosis for these traits. Out of forty two crosses, six crosses for days to 50 per cent flowering, 1 cross for heat injury, 2 crosses for proline content and 3 crosses for total chlorophyll content expressed desirable significant better-parent heterosis. In case of economic heterosis, one different cross showed desirable significant economic heterosis for days to 50 per cent flowering, heat injury and proline content.
